Class Tombstone
java.lang.Object
org.opensearch.client.opensearch.cluster.Tombstone
- All Implemented Interfaces:
ToJsonp
public final class Tombstone extends java.lang.Object implements ToJsonp
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classTombstone.BuilderBuilder forTombstone. -
Field Summary
Fields Modifier and Type Field Description static JsonpDeserializer<Tombstone>DESERIALIZERJson deserializer for Tombstone -
Constructor Summary
Constructors Modifier Constructor Description protectedTombstone(Tombstone.Builder builder) -
Method Summary
Modifier and Type Method Description java.lang.StringdeleteDate()API name:delete_datejava.lang.NumberdeleteDateInMillis()API name:delete_date_in_millisTombstoneIndexindex()API name:indexprotected static voidsetupTombstoneDeserializer(DelegatingDeserializer<Tombstone.Builder> op)voidtoJsonp(jakarta.json.stream.JsonGenerator generator, JsonpMapper mapper)Serialize this object to JSON.protected voidtoJsonpInternal(jakarta.json.stream.JsonGenerator generator, JsonpMapper mapper)
-
Field Details
-
DESERIALIZER
Json deserializer for Tombstone
-
-
Constructor Details
-
Method Details
-
index
API name:index -
deleteDate
@Nullable public java.lang.String deleteDate()API name:delete_date -
deleteDateInMillis
public java.lang.Number deleteDateInMillis()API name:delete_date_in_millis -
toJsonp
Serialize this object to JSON. -
toJsonpInternal
-
setupTombstoneDeserializer
-